by vlad01
yeah getting closer now.
tail shaft and diff after the box gets a rebuild, some more suspension stuff and steering rack.
Will book the car in for spring time to the paint shop. To get the bonnet, engine bay, front/rear bumpers, grille repainted and dent under the right tail light done. Then hand cut and polish the rest and will look nearly as good as new. Thinking 2 pack for the paint since the bumpers are factory 2 pack while the rest is acrylic. it will be more durable for those parts of the car hence why they are in need to be done as only those areas have deteriorated while the rest is in very good condition.
Once the drive train is in the custom exhaust will be the last major thing. Then usual interior stuff as well as removal of sound deadener.

Where did you get the counter shaft retainers from I've heard varying things about different brands and people making them saying the move around to much on screws or hit on 5th gear?
Re: Vlad's rides thread
Posted: Thu Mar 10, 2016 12:49 pm
by vlad01
I got them from thegearbox.org.
They are counter sunk 10.9 screws, certainly won't move. The plate is 8mm thick, vs the 2mm or so pressed sheet OEM plates.
